Understanding the Role of Materials in Photovoltaic Glass Production

When planning solar energy projects in Kuwait's harsh climate, a common question arises: Does photovoltaic glass need stone components? The answer lies in understanding both material science and local environmental factors. While stone isn't directly used in glass manufacturing, it plays indirect roles in structural support and thermal management.

Key Material Components in Solar Glass

  • Silica sand (primary raw material)
  • Anti-reflective coatings
  • Tempering chemicals
  • Stone aggregates (for mounting systems)

FAQ: Photovoltaic Glass in Arid Climates

Does sand damage photovoltaic glass?

While Kuwait's sandstorms can reduce efficiency by 8-12% annually, modern glass coatings minimize abrasion when properly maintained.

What's the lifespan of solar panels in desert conditions?

Quality photovoltaic systems typically maintain 85%+ efficiency after 15 years, even with daily temperature fluctuations of 30°C+.
